10 commandments to weight loss

Image
  Good health is not something we can purchase,rather  it can be an extremely valuable savings account. Here are some tips for weight loss!   1. Never skip your breakfast.  2.Eat 3 big meals and 2- 3 snacks 3.Maintain portion size and avoid junk like bakery products, white sugar and alcohol too. 3.Eat consciously. Eat whatever is  gives you the required nutrients.    4.Eat home cooked  and locally grown food.I reduced weight eating white rice, so can you.   5.Have warm water with chia seeds/tulsi or mint leaves. (TOTAL FLUID INTAKE PER DAY-2.5 L). 6. Eat locally grown seasonal fruits like jackfruit,oranges,mangoes,bananas.  You need not eat exotic ,costly fruits like kiwi,dragon fruit etc  7. Have a sustainable diet plan which you can follow life long.           8. Walking is  the most sustainable  and easiest exercise. Can be done anywhere and anytime.      ...

Pandemic Workouts

Image
 There has been an air of melancholy ever since the uncanny  pandemic has set in. Staying cooped up at home without much human interaction can be physically and mentally stressful.  Gyms are shut and outdoor exercise is off the table with all of your socializing happening on Zoom and Google meet .Doing easy home exercises during lockdown can be highly rewarding once you get the hang of it. It can become one of your lockdown solutions that makes you feel productive while making you fitter. Exercise has a couple of positive impacts on the immune system. According to a study , frequent physical activity can limit and delay ageing of the immune system. Other than the long-term effects, even a small amount of exercise can increase the production of natural killer cells in the body - these cells make up the immune system’s second line of defence.
